The Midtown Group is a premier WBENC-certified, woman-owned staffing and solutions provider. As the “Best Place to Work” for high-performance entrepreneurial staffing professionals, The Midtown Group provides the most qualified resources specializing in IT, Legal, and Professional Services, to solve client problems and achieve their goals with the right solution, delivered with speed unmatched by competitors. With skilled professionals across the country, we offer contract, contract-to-hire, and direct hire solutions to the public and private sector. Currently, we are supporting 170+ government and commercial organizations in 36 states. We are proud to formally introduce the expansion of our public sector team headlined by Vice President of Public Sector and Government Services, Tasha Morris, who has led Midtown in growing its work extensively with federal, state, and local government agencies in the last 19 years. Robert Russell, who joined The Midtown Group in July 2023, heads the client capture and service delivery aspects of our team as Senior Director of Capture Strategy & Operations. Lorie DuBasky serves as the team’s Senior Growth Capture Manager of Federal Services, while Joanna Swann has taken the reins in developing our recruitment and service delivery strategies as Director of Talent Fulfillment & Delivery for the Public Sector. Jose Contin and Lisa Gardner lead the delivery of Midtown's public sector projects, while Nancy Green continues to direct our public sector proposals. This team has already accomplished so much for the team and our government clients over the last year, and we are so ready to reach “Everest” sized heights together over the next year.
